globel = 0 # 全局变量 class test(object): hh = 1 # 类变量 所有实例共用变量 def __init__(self): self.tmp = 1 # 实例变量 实例特有,互不干涉 local = 0 # 局部变量 函数执行完后会被回收 def add_first(self): self.tmp += 1 test.hh += 1 print(self.tmp,test.hh) def add_second(self): self.tmp += 1 test.hh += 1 print(self.tmp,test.hh) dd = test() dd.add_first() 2 2 dd.add_second() 3 3 hh = test() hh.add_first() 2 4